当你的世界突然变蓝:一次奇怪的Minecraft触摸实验
凌晨2点37分,我第13次用食指戳向手机屏幕。那个该死的草方块依然在触碰瞬间泛起诡异的蓝光,像被施了魔法——这完全违背了我八年MC老玩家的认知。
一、不是光影bug的怪事
最开始以为是新安装的Complementary Shaders出了问题。但关掉所有光影后,用生存模式新建的橡木木板还是会在触摸时变成#4A7CFF这种精确的钴蓝色。更诡异的是:
- 只有手指直接接触的单个方块变色
- 变色持续约0.8秒后恢复
- 创造模式下用物品点击不会触发
1.1 排除法开始
我的三星S21突然变得像个烫手山芋:
测试项 | 结果 |
重启游戏 | 依旧变蓝 |
更换皮肤包 | 无效 |
关闭触控反馈 | 症状消失! |
二、藏在系统深处的触觉陷阱
翻遍Android 13的开发者选项才发现,某个叫"触摸视觉反馈"的选项被神秘开启了。这功能本意是让用户看到触摸位置,但不知怎么和Minecraft的渲染引擎产生了量子纠缠。
具体原理可能涉及:
- OpenGL ES的帧缓冲冲突
- 游戏触控事件优先级错乱
- 三星One UI对Unity的过度优化
2.1 来自Reddit的佐证
在r/MCPE板块搜到2023年类似的帖子,楼主描述的症状和我完全吻合。下面有人提到更离谱的情况——触碰苦力怕会触发手机震动,这简直是把恐怖游戏体验拉满。
三、临时解决方案与后遗症
虽然关闭系统反馈能解决问题,但带来两个新麻烦:
- 打字时失去触控提示容易误触
- 玩其他需要精确操作的游戏变得困难
现在每次打开MC都要做心理建设——要忍受0.8秒的蓝色幻影,还是要放弃所有触觉反馈?这个两难选择让我想起《Minecraft: The Lost Worlds》里那句台词:"有时候修复bug会创造更大的bug"。
窗外鸟叫了,晨光透过窗帘照在还在发烫的手机上。我决定保留这个蓝色特效,毕竟它让平凡的挖矿变成了触发霓虹灯的行为艺术。谁知道呢,说不定哪天Mojang会把它变成正式特性,就像当年偶然加入的爬行机制那样。